Fuel costs fell by 11 cents per gallon from every week in the past, immersed in lots of locations in Michigan beneath $ 3 per gallon and will go decrease, however analysts mentioned that development may not be sustainable.

In keeping with AAA, Michigan drivers paid a median of $ 3.04 per gallon for normal perpendicular on Sundays. That’s 7 cents lower than this time final month and 68 cents lower than this time final yr.

It’s also beneath the nationwide common of $ 3.15 per gallon.

“The gasoline costs in Michigan have fallen,” mentioned AAA spokeswoman Adrienne Woodland within the weekly gas report of the Auto Membership, and added that many motorists all through the state “see costs beneath $ 3 per gallon.”

The most costly gasoline averages within the state had been in Ann Arbor, $ 3.11 per gallon; Metro Detroit, $ 3.07; and Marquette, $ 3.03; And the least was in Benton Harbor, $ 2.95; Jackson, $ 2.96; and flint, $ 2.97.
